Léa Sassier is a specialist in sustainable buildings with eight years of expertise in energy renovation, particularly in housing. They have held various roles, including project manager and energy advisor at HESPUL and the Agence Locale de la Transition Énergétique du Rhône, where they supported numerous energy-saving projects and trained professionals in energy transition. Currently, Léa serves as a trainer and project manager for energy renovation at La Solive and as a project manager for Mediterranean sustainable buildings at EnvirobatBDM. They hold a professional license in energy and environmental management from Université de Montpellier and an associate degree in civil engineering from Université Grenoble Alpes.
